@Service
public class GLClosureJournalEntryBalanceReadPlatformServiceImpl
        implements GLClosureJournalEntryBalanceReadPlatformService {

    private final JdbcTemplate jdbcTemplate;
    private final DateTimeFormatter mysqlDateFormatter = DateTimeFormat.forPattern("yyyy-MM-dd");
    private final DateTimeFormatter fileOutputDateFormatter = DateTimeFormat.forPattern("MM/dd/yyyy");
    private final GLClosureJournalEntryBalanceValidator glClosureJournalEntryBalanceValidator;
    private final OfficeReadPlatformService officeReadPlatformService;
    private final GLClosureReadPlatformService glClosureReadPlatformService;
    private final NamedParameterJdbcTemplate namedParameterJdbcTemplate;
    private final ConfigurationDomainService configurationDomainService;
    private final static Logger logger = LoggerFactory
            .getLogger(GLClosureJournalEntryBalanceReadPlatformServiceImpl.class);

    /**
     *
     */
    @Autowired
    public GLClosureJournalEntryBalanceReadPlatformServiceImpl(final RoutingDataSource routingDataSource,
            final GLClosureJournalEntryBalanceValidator glClosureJournalEntryBalanceValidator,
            final OfficeReadPlatformService officeReadPlatformService,
            final GLClosureReadPlatformService glClosureReadPlatformService,
            final ConfigurationDomainService configurationDomainService) {
        this.jdbcTemplate = new JdbcTemplate(routingDataSource);
        this.glClosureJournalEntryBalanceValidator = glClosureJournalEntryBalanceValidator;
        this.officeReadPlatformService = officeReadPlatformService;
        this.glClosureReadPlatformService = glClosureReadPlatformService;
        this.namedParameterJdbcTemplate = new NamedParameterJdbcTemplate(routingDataSource);
        this.configurationDomainService = configurationDomainService;
    }

    public static final class GLClosureJournalEntryDataMapper implements RowMapper<GLClosureJournalEntryData> {

        /**
         * SQL statement for retrieving the journal entries
         * @return SQL statement string
         */
        public String sql() {
            return "je.id, je.account_id, je.office_id, je.entry_date, je.created_date, je.amount, je.description, "
                    + "IF(ac.classification_enum IN (1,5), je.organization_running_balance, -1 * je.organization_running_balance) as organization_running_balance, "
                    + "IF(ac.classification_enum IN (1,5), je.office_running_balance, -1 * je.office_running_balance) as office_running_balance "
                    + "from acc_gl_account as ac "
                    + "inner join ( select * from (select * from acc_gl_journal_entry "
                    + "where office_id = ? and entry_date <= ? " + "and is_running_balance_calculated = 1 "
                    + "order by entry_date desc, created_date desc, id desc ) t group by t.account_id ) "
                    + "as je on je.account_id = ac.id " + "group by je.account_id, je.office_id "
                    + "order by entry_date, created_date ";
        }

        @Override
        public GLClosureJournalEntryData mapRow(ResultSet rs, int rowNum) throws SQLException {
            final Long id = rs.getLong("id");
            final Long accountId = rs.getLong("account_id");
            final Long officeId = rs.getLong("office_id");
            final LocalDate entryDate = JdbcSupport.getLocalDate(rs, "entry_date");
            final DateTime createdDateTime = JdbcSupport.getDateTime(rs, "created_date");
            final BigDecimal amount = JdbcSupport.getBigDecimalDefaultToZeroIfNull(rs, "amount");
            final BigDecimal organisationRunningBalance = JdbcSupport.getBigDecimalDefaultToZeroIfNull(rs,
                    "organization_running_balance");
            final BigDecimal officeRunningBalance = JdbcSupport.getBigDecimalDefaultToZeroIfNull(rs,
                    "office_running_balance");
            final String description = rs.getString("description");

            LocalDateTime createdDate = null;

            if (createdDateTime != null) {
                createdDate = new LocalDateTime(createdDateTime);
            }

            return GLClosureJournalEntryData.instance(id, accountId, officeId, entryDate, createdDate, amount,
                    organisationRunningBalance, officeRunningBalance, description);
        }
    }

    @Override
    public Collection<GLClosureJournalEntryData> retrieveAllJournalEntries(Long officeId, LocalDate maxEntryDate) {
        final GLClosureJournalEntryDataMapper mapper = new GLClosureJournalEntryDataMapper();
        final String sql = "select " + mapper.sql();

        return this.jdbcTemplate.query(sql, mapper,
                new Object[] { officeId, this.mysqlDateFormatter.print(maxEntryDate) });
    }

    public static final class GLClosureAccountBalanceReportMapper
            implements RowMapper<GLClosureAccountBalanceReportData> {
        private final GLClosureData endClosure;
        private final GLClosureData startClosure;
        private final String reference;

        /**
         * SQL statement that will calculate GL closure account balance
         * @return SQL statement string
         */
        public String sql() {
            String sql = "sc.account_id, sc.account_number, sc.account_name, (ec.amount - sc.amount) as amount, sc.closureId as closureId "
                    + "from "
                    + "(select je.account_id as account_id, ga.gl_code as account_number, ga.name as account_name, sum(amount) as amount, je.closure_id as closureId "
                    + "from acc_gl_closure_journal_entry_balance je " + "inner join acc_gl_closure gc "
                    + "on gc.id = je.closure_id " + "inner join acc_gl_account ga " + "on ga.id = je.account_id "
                    + "where gc.office_id in " + "(:officeIds) " + "and gc.closing_date = :startClosureClosingDate "
                    + "and je.is_deleted = 0 " + "group by je.account_id) sc " + "inner join "
                    + "(select je.account_id as account_id, ga.gl_code as account_number, sum(amount) as amount "
                    + "from acc_gl_closure_journal_entry_balance je " + "inner join acc_gl_closure gc "
                    + "on gc.id = je.closure_id " + "inner join acc_gl_account ga " + "on ga.id = je.account_id "
                    + "where gc.office_id in " + "(:officeIds) " + "and gc.closing_date = :endClosureClosingDate "
                    + "and je.is_deleted = 0 " + "group by je.account_id) ec " + "on sc.account_id = ec.account_id "
                    + "order by account_number ";

            if (this.startClosure == null) {
                sql = "je.account_id as account_id, ga.gl_code as account_number, ga.name as account_name, sum(amount) as amount, je.closure_id as closureId "
                        + "from acc_gl_closure_journal_entry_balance je " + "inner join acc_gl_closure gc "
                        + "on gc.id = je.closure_id " + "inner join acc_gl_account ga "
                        + "on ga.id = je.account_id " + "where gc.office_id in " + "(:officeIds) "
                        + "and gc.closing_date = :endClosureClosingDate " + "and je.is_deleted = 0 "
                        + "group by je.account_id " + "order by account_number ";
            }

            return sql;
        }

        /**
         * @param endClosure
         * @param startClosure
         */
        public GLClosureAccountBalanceReportMapper(final GLClosureData endClosure, final GLClosureData startClosure,
                final String reference) {
            this.endClosure = endClosure;
            this.startClosure = startClosure;
            this.reference = reference;
        }

        @Override
        public GLClosureAccountBalanceReportData mapRow(ResultSet rs, int rowNum) throws SQLException {
            final String accountNumber = rs.getString("account_number");
            final String accountName = rs.getString("account_name");
            final LocalDate postedDate = new LocalDate();
            final BigDecimal amount = JdbcSupport.getBigDecimalDefaultToZeroIfNull(rs, "amount");
            final Long closureId = rs.getLong("closureId");

            LocalDate transactionDate = null;

            if (this.endClosure != null) {
                transactionDate = this.endClosure.getClosingDate();
            }

            return GLClosureAccountBalanceReportData.instance(accountNumber, transactionDate, postedDate, amount,
                    this.reference, closureId, accountName);
        }
    }

    @Override
    public File generateGLClosureAccountBalanceReport(MultivaluedMap<String, String> uriQueryParameters) {
        final boolean aggregateBalanceOfSubOffices = UriQueryParameterHelper
                .aggregateBalanceOfSubOffices(uriQueryParameters);
        final Long officeId = UriQueryParameterHelper.getOfficeId(uriQueryParameters);
        final Long startClosureId = UriQueryParameterHelper.getStartClosureId(uriQueryParameters);
        final Long endClosureId = UriQueryParameterHelper.getEndClosureId(uriQueryParameters);
        final String reference = UriQueryParameterHelper.getReference(uriQueryParameters);
        final GLClosureFileFormat fileFormat = GLClosureFileFormat
                .fromInteger(Integer.valueOf(UriQueryParameterHelper.getFileFormat(uriQueryParameters)));

        GLClosureData endClosure = null;
        GLClosureData startClosure = null;

        if (endClosureId != null) {
            endClosure = this.glClosureReadPlatformService.retrieveGLClosureById(endClosureId);
        }

        if (startClosureId != null) {
            startClosure = this.glClosureReadPlatformService.retrieveGLClosureById(startClosureId);
        }

        this.glClosureJournalEntryBalanceValidator.validateGenerateReportRequest(officeId, startClosure,
                endClosure);

        Collection<Long> officeIds = new ArrayList<Long>();

        // add the value of the "officeId" variable to the array list
        officeIds.add(officeId);

        if (aggregateBalanceOfSubOffices) {
            officeIds = this.officeReadPlatformService.officeByHierarchy(officeId);
        }

        final GLClosureAccountBalanceReportMapper mapper = new GLClosureAccountBalanceReportMapper(endClosure,
                startClosure, reference);
        final String sql = "select " + mapper.sql();

        MapSqlParameterSource sqlParameterSource = new MapSqlParameterSource();

        String startClosureClosingDate = null;
        String endClosureClosingDate = this.mysqlDateFormatter.print(endClosure.getClosingDate());

        if (startClosure != null) {
            startClosureClosingDate = this.mysqlDateFormatter.print(startClosure.getClosingDate());
        }

        sqlParameterSource.addValue("officeIds", officeIds);
        sqlParameterSource.addValue("startClosureClosingDate", startClosureClosingDate);
        sqlParameterSource.addValue("endClosureClosingDate", endClosureClosingDate);

        final Collection<GLClosureAccountBalanceReportData> reportDataList = this.namedParameterJdbcTemplate
                .query(sql, sqlParameterSource, mapper);
        if (fileFormat.isCsv()) {
            return this.createGLClosureAccountBalanceReportCsvFile(reportDataList);
        } else if (fileFormat.isGP()) {
            return this.createGLClosureAccountBalanceReportGreatPlainsFile(reportDataList);
        } else if (fileFormat.isT24()) {
            return this.createGLClosureAccountBalanceReportT24File(reportDataList);
        }

        return null;
    }
